ISSZI TWS gnsr. gy Top row, left to right—Howard Quaintance, Harrison Gingrich, Wayne Sebert, Wayne Bowman, Paul McDonald, Howard Hine, Ralph Imes, Loren Yarlot. Second row—Dorothy Goodwin, Lois Johnson, Vera Kester, Velma Brooks, Maxine Johnson, Geraldine Rufner. First row—Hilda Kohl, Ruth Miller, Maxine McEntarfer, Helen Moyer, Dorothy Crooks, Florence Call JUNIOR CLASS HISTORY In the year of nineteen hundred twenty-eight a group of thirty pupils entered the Waterloo High School in their Freshmen year. When the class was organized they chose as their motto “Work and Win,” Class flower, Lily of the Valley and class colors, pencil blue and grey. A committee was selected to choose the class pennant which was obtained after some delay. It was hung with great pride among the pennants, and shines forth to represent our class through its high school days. During the year we lost one member but gained a new one. In September ninteen hundred twenty nine, twenty six pupils returned to take up their studies in the Sophmore year. Shortly after school commenced class pins were purchased in remembrance of our sophmore year. At the freshman reception we had the honor of serving the luncheon. As activities during the year, a Hallowe’en party was held at the home of Ruth Miller. During the year we lost one member and gained one. We entered the Junior year with twenty-four pupils. When the class organized they chose their President, Dorothy Crooks; Vice President, Howard Hine; Secretary and Treasurer Loren Yarlot; Poet, Velma Brooks. A party was held at the home of Velma Brooks for the purpose of planning the reception. It was decided that it should be at the home of Dorothy Goodwin on April thirtieth. Class rings were pur¬ chased. The Juniors also took part in the literary and musical contest. There were two members lost this year and one gained. This is the history of the graduating class of Nineteen hundred and thirty two, thus far. We hope that our last year shall be as fortunate as our first three years have been. --Velma Brooks, ’32.
